I know I’m beating a dead horse here, but how is Daniel Day-Lewis not the frontrunner for Best Actor? He’s virtually sweeping the critics awards, and I can’t remember when someone with that much dominance wasn’t eventually the winner with Oscar. I guess you can look at Julianne Moore, but Far From Heaven didn’t get the overall noms that Blood is likely to, and I think the Academy was much more desperate to crown Nicole Kidman than they are to do the same with Johnny Depp. Kidman’s work was also much more in line with what wins than Depp’s portrayal.
If Clooney wins SAG and/or the Globe, then maybe things are murkier, but I’d say he’s a longshot for Oscar because he just won recently. So it’s still essentially a 2-horse race. But I don’t know if what Depp has done is going to appear all that fearless or accomplished next to DDL. It’s not like Depp was a revelation as a singer or dancer like what we saw with Catherine Zeta-Jones in Chicago, or that he showed a new side of his acting abilities. It’s just an obvious, fitting match between actor and character, director and material.
